MOLTON BROWN
Live illustration for Molton Brown by Marcella Wylie, hand painting perfume bottles and hosted by Clarendon Fine Art
I was recently invited by Molton Brown to bring a unique artistic touch to a special event at Clarendon Fine Art in Edinburgh’s St James Quarter. A beautiful evening that celebrated both perfume and creativity in equal measure.
The event was held in honour of Mesmerising Oudh Accord & Gold, one of Molton Brown’s most opulent and rich fragrances, and formed part of their inspiring Artist of Note campaign.
My role was to live illustrate and hand paint bespoke artwork directly onto fragrance bottles, creating personal keepsakes for each guest. It was a wonderfully interactive experience blending the art of scent with the art of illustration in real time, surrounded by original artwork and the buzz of a warm, creative crowd.
There’s something really special about live painting; it is immediate, thoughtful, completely bespoke and one of a kind. It was a joy to meet each guest, hear their reactions, and create something meaningful for them to take home.
